What Types of Insurance Does Westfield Offer?
Westfield Insurance offers a wide array of insurance products to cater to diverse needs. Their core offerings typically include:
- Auto Insurance: Covering liability, collision, comprehensive, and u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age. They often offer various discounts and flexible payment options.
- Home Insurance: Protecting your home and belongings from various perils, including fire, theft, and weather damage. Coverage amounts and deductibles can be customized to fit individual budgets.
- Business Insurance: Catering to various business types and sizes, with options for general liability, commercial auto, and workers' compensation. This often includes tailored packages to address specific business risks.
- Farm Insurance: A specialized area focusing on the unique needs of agricultural operations, encompassing property, liability, and crop insurance. This reflects Westfield's history and commitment to serving rural communities.
- Life Insurance: Protecting your loved ones financially in the event of your passing. This may include term life, whole life, and other types of life insurance policies. (Specific availability may vary by location.)
Is Westfield Insurance Right for Me?
This is a highly personalized question. The suitability of Westfield Insurance depends entirely on your individual circumstances, needs, and risk profile. Several factors to consider include:
- Your Location: Westfield Insurance primarily operates in the Midwest, so coverage availability may vary depending on your geographic location.
- Your Insurance Needs: Do you need basic coverage or comprehensive protection? Do you own a home, a business, or both? Westfield’s wide range of products caters to different needs, but some specialized coverage might not be available everywhere.
- Your Budget: Insurance premiums vary based on several factors, including your risk profile, the amount of coverage, and the type of policy. Comparing quotes from multiple insurers is always advisable.
- Your Customer Service Preferences: Customer service is a key differentiator. Researching reviews and testimonials can help determine whether Westfield's approach aligns with your expectations.

What is Westfield Insurance's Financial Stability Rating?
The financial strength of an insurance company is vital. While I cannot provide specific ratings here (as they can change and should be independently verified), it's crucial to research the company's financial stability before committing to a policy. Independent rating agencies such as A.M. Best, Moody's, and Standard & Poor's provide assessments that can inform your decision.
